I work part time tutoring and giving lessons teaching English aside from being a student at the UGA in Grenoble learning the French language. I am from America and English is my native language. My private sessions are aimed towards adults looking to improve their English speaking skills through conversation and different exercises aimed at improving their specific needs. Lessons are tailored for every individuals specific needs. For example, learning vocabulary in different contexts of professionalism or travel, conversational skills, completing homework or other assignments in English, or even translating documents from French into English for school or work.
